Eco-friendly materials used in heels production are becoming increasingly popular, and for good reason. They not only reduce waste but also provide a more humane and animal-friendly option. Some of the most environmentally-friendly materials used in heels production include:
Eco-friendly synthetic fibers like recycled nylon and polyamide, which reduce the need for virgin plastics.
Piñatex, a sustainable fabric made from pineapple leaf fibers, which would otherwise be discarded.
Vegetable-tanned leather, which uses plant-based tannins instead of harsh chemicals.
| Eco-Friendly Material | Description | Benefits |
|---|---|---|
| Recycled Nylon | Made from post-consumer plastic waste | Reduces waste, conserves resources |
| Piñatex | Made from pineapple leaf fibers | Sustainable production process |
| Vegetable-Tanned Leather | Uses plant-based tannins | Reduced environmental impact |

Now, let’s talk about second-hand and vintage heels. These options have become increasingly popular, and for good reason. They’re sustainable, stylish, and often come with a unique story.
Advantages of Second-Hand and Vintage Heels, Heels shoes near me
Buying second-hand or vintage heels has numerous advantages, including:
Lower carbon footprint: Reducing the need for new, resource-intensive production.
Unique style: Each piece is one-of-a-kind, adding a touch of personality to your outfit.
Cost-effective: Second-hand heels can be a fraction of the cost of new ones.
Disadvantages of Vintage Heels
While second-hand and vintage heels have their advantages, there are also some disadvantages to consider:
Unpredictable quality: Vintage heels may be worn or damaged, affecting their quality.
Limited availability: You may struggle to find the style or size you want.
Tips for Buying Vintage Heels
When buying vintage heels, keep the following tips in mind:
Research, research, research: Understand the market value and popularity of the style.
Inspect before you buy: Look for signs of wear or damage.
Consider restoration: Sometimes, a little TLC can make a vintage heel shine like new.

Leather vs. Synthetic Materials: Which is Better?
Leather heels have long been the gold standard for footwear, but synthetic materials have gained popularity in recent years. While synthetic heels offer excellent durability and affordability, they might not provide the same level of luxury feel and aesthetics as leather. Here’s a comparison of these two materials:
| Material | Strengths | Weaknesses |
| — | — | — |
| Leather | Luxurious feel, breathable, and durable | Can be heavy, prone to scratches, and requires maintenance |
| Synthetic | Lighter, affordable, and resistant to water and stains | Can feel less luxurious, lacks breathability, and may not be as durable |
Ultimately, the choice between leather and synthetic materials comes down to your personal preferences and needs. If you prioritize comfort, breathability, and durability, leather might be the better choice. However, if you’re looking for a more affordable, lightweight option, synthetic materials are definitely worth considering.

Q: What is the best way to choose the right heel size and width?
A: To ensure a comfortable fit, try on heels in the afternoon when your feet are at their largest. Measure your foot length and width to determine your ideal heel size and width. You can also read reviews from other customers who have purchased the same heel to get an idea of the size and fit.
Q: Can I wear high heels every day?
A: It’s not recommended to wear high heels every day as it can lead to discomfort, pain, and potentially long-term damage to your feet and joints. You can wear high heels for special occasions or try to incorporate them into your daily wear in moderation.
Q: How do I take care of my heels to make them last longer?
A: To extend the lifespan of your heels, make sure to clean them regularly, avoid exposing them to water, and store them in a cool, dry place. You can also apply a waterproofing spray to protect the materials from stains and water damage.
